How much do cnc wire cut programmer j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 19, 2026, the average hourly pay for cnc wire cut programmer in the United States is $30.96,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$25.48 and $34.86 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Cnc Wire Cut Programmer position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a CNC Wire Cut Programmer, you need strong knowledge of CNC programming, mechanical drawing interpretation, and precision measurement, often backed by a diploma or certification in mechanical engineering or machining. Familiarity with CAD/CAM software, wire EDM (Electrical Discharge Machining) machines, and specific controls like FANUC or Mitsubishi is essential. Attention to detail, problem-solving abilities, and effective communication help professionals excel in this role. These skills ensure high accuracy, efficient workflow, and effective collaboration with machinists and engineers in a manufacturing environment.

What are some typical challenges faced by CNC Wire Cut Programmers, and how can they be managed?

CNC Wire Cut Programmers often encounter challenges related to programming complex geometries, maintaining tight tolerances, and optimizing machining cycles to minimize waste and downtime. Managing these challenges requires a deep understanding of both the software and the physical machining process, as well as proactive troubleshooting and communication with the production team. Staying updated on new technology and regularly reviewing machining strategies can also help mitigate common issues. By embracing continuous learning and teamwork, programmers can enhance efficiency and ensure high-quality results in fast-paced manufacturing settings.

What is a CNC Wire Cut Programmer job?

A CNC Wire Cut Programmer is responsible for creating and optimizing wire EDM (Electrical Discharge Machining) programs to cut precision parts from metal and other conductive materials. They interpret engineering drawings, select appropriate cutting parameters, and use CAD/CAM software to generate toolpaths. In addition, they set up and troubleshoot CNC wire cut machines to ensure accuracy and efficiency. This role requires knowledge of machine operations, material properties, and quality control standards to produce high-precision components.
